<p>Firefighters battled a large fire that broke out on the rooftop of a building under construction on New York City’s Upper East Side on Tuesday, May 9.</p><p>ABC 7 reported</a> the fire broke out just after 2 pm at East 83rd Street and Park Avenue. The building normally houses Jesuit priests but was vacant at the time due to renovations.</p><p>A nearby school was evacuated and the flames were under control in about 30 minutes.</p><br />
